Domain extensions, also known as top-level domains (TLDs), are the suffixes at the end of a web address. While .com has long been the go-to choice, the internet has expanded to include hundreds of new TLDs, offering endless possibilities for personalization. These unique domain extensions are often industry-specific, location-based, or creatively branded, such as:

With millions of websites competing for attention, a unique domain extension can help you differentiate yourself. For example, a coffee shop could use www.bestcoffee.shop instead of a generic `.com domain. This instantly communicates what the website is about and makes it easier for users to remember.
Your domain name is a key part of your brand identity. A unique extension can reinforce your niche or industry, making your website more relevant to your audience. For instance, a tech startup might choose .tech to emphasize its innovative focus, while a photographer could opt for .photography to showcase their expertise.
While domain extensions themselves don’t directly impact SEO rankings, a relevant and keyword-rich domain name can improve click-through rates (CTR) and user engagement—both of which are important ranking factors. For example, a local bakery using www.bestcakes.nyc might attract more clicks from New York-based users searching for cakes.
Finding an available .com domain can feel like searching for a needle in a haystack. Unique domain extensions open up a world of possibilities, allowing you to secure shorter, more memorable names that might otherwise be unavailable.
Keep It Relevant: Choose an extension that aligns with your industry, niche, or target audience. For example, if you’re a fitness coach, .fitness is a natural fit.
Prioritize Simplicity: Avoid overly long or complicated domain names. A short, easy-to-remember name is more likely to stick in users’ minds.
Consider Your Audience: Think about what will resonate with your target audience. A playful extension like .fun might work for a party planning business, but a more professional extension like .lawyer would be better for a legal firm.
Check for Trademarks: Before registering your domain, ensure it doesn’t infringe on any existing trademarks to avoid legal issues down the line.
Think About the Future: Choose a domain name and extension that will grow with your brand. Avoid overly specific names that might limit your business’s potential expansion.
